Vidikron:
PS3 is only profile 1.1. And it's not the only 1.1 player. There are no profile 2.0 BD players right now. 2.0 brings internet access, which I do not want on my disc player anyway. I'm not saying I don't value it, I say I explicitly want my disc player to not have it.

Content providers (disc makers) did the worst stuff with the "cannot fast forward now" codes on DVDs, they make us watch 8 shitty previews to see the movie we paid for. The only thing that stops them from making it worse is that word would get around that the disc isn't worth buying if it had 20 unskippable previews in front. Well, with internet access in there, they'll make it not show the previews until they update their website. So they'll wait until they sell 5 million copies of the disc and then turn on huge unskippable ads.

When you buy a disc that contacts the internet, you never know what you are getting. They could completely deactivate the disc remotely if they want at a future date. I don't want internet access on my disc player.

@LS2/LS7

That's why I said 2.0 "capable". It's 1.1 now (1 of only a few available), but the only main requirements for 2.0 are the ability to go online and 1 GB of internal storage. The PS3 meets all the requirements for 2.0 and is the only player currently on the market that does. Much like profile 1.1, Sony will make the PS3 2.0 compliant via a firmware update as soon as 2.0 movies get close to hitting store shelves.

I also have an HD DVD player and I do agree that the internet stuff is largely overrated. I don't care about the ability to vote and polls and such and I can already download trailers via the Live Marketplace and PSN. But if you want a BR player that is largely future proof, the PS3 is the only player right now that makes sense. None of the other players out now can do 2.0 now or ever.
